When thinking about what type of insurance plan to purchase from your employer, keep in mind the overall health issues of everyone in your family. This is a balancing act, becasue you may choose to buy less insurance coverage because of the lower premiums and the fact that you have no current or expected health issues. This will save you money in the short term, but may cost you if you have an accident or a medical issue appears later.

If your eyes already have issues, or vision problems exist in your home, then vision insurance proves a smart buy. This insurance will handle a certain percent of the cost of eye care related expenses, such as glasses and doctor visits. Insurance for your vision is not required, and many people find they save money by not having a vision plan if they do not have any risk factors.

It is wise to look over your prescription insurance plan at least once a year. Insurance companies will revise their rules regarding prescriptions on a yearly basis, so take the time to read the new rules before you re-enroll. If you have daily medications that your current insurance stops covering, find a new provider.

TIP! It does not matter which type of health insurance you have, everyone will save money if they choose to get generic drugs when filling a prescription. There are only a few drugs that you can not get in a generic form, and there have been many studies that have shown there is not any difference between these and a name brand pill.

You can get catastrophic insurance instead of comprehensive to save cash. Catastrophic coverage only covers major medical expenses, like hospitalization and emergency surgeries; in comparison, comprehensive covers that, plus most minor health care related costs like physicals and prescriptions.

For those who do not have the money for a regular and complete health insurance policy, but would like to be covered for unforeseen accidents, injuries or a serious illness, catastrophic health insurance is a good alternative. Even if you have insurance already, catastrophic coverage can provide extra protection against unusual events.

HSAs (savings accounts designed specifically to cover your health needs) are a consideration when you only occasionally visit the doctor. You can save money you do not pay on insurance, and it can go straight into this account to pay for medicines and doctors, if needed.
